When Adobe announced that they were going to open up their productivity software to monthly and yearly rentals, it was taken by many to be a sign of things to come in the professional software market.

Instead of having to pay full price for access to software you may replace every year as new versions become available, you have the option of renting the license on a short-term basis.

To be clear, you're already technically renting software when you purchase it. It doesn't matter if you purchase a retail box or pay for a direct download version of the program, the license itself is all you're really paying for. That license can be valid indefinitely, or it may come with a limited term of support.

If given a choice, would you prefer to pay full price, or rent your software at a lower rate for a restricted amount of time?
